The Celina Bobcats will challenge the Van Vandals on Thursday. The two teams are sauntering into the matchup backed by comfortable wins in their prior games.
Celina is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Tuesday. They put the hurt on Life Waxahachie with a sharp 3-0 win.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Bobcats.

Addilyn Paulson and Sonny Hoya were among the main playmakers for Celina as the former had 16 digs and the latter had five digs. That's the most digs Paulson has posted since back in October.
Meanwhile, Van made easy work of Caddo Mills on Tuesday and carried off a 3-0 victory.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est win the Vandals have posted against the Foxes since November 4, 2019.
Celina's victory bumped their record up to 20-24. As for Van, their win bumped their record up to 32-7.
Celina took their victory against Van in their previous meeting back in November of 2021 by a conclusive 3-0 score. Will the Bobcats repeat their success, or do the Vandals have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
